Recorded constituents

What analytical work has found in this species, at which plant part and preparation. A measured constituent is a fact about material, not about effect.

SubstancePlant partPreparationConcentrationAnalytical methodSource
1,8-cineoleLeavesEssential oil5.3 PercentGC-MSResolve DOI
BergamottinFruit peelSolvent extraction29.7 Microgram/100 millilitreHigh Performance Liquid Chromatography (HPLC)/Liquid Chromatography (LC)Resolve DOI
BergaptenFruit peelSolvent extractionHigh Performance Liquid Chromatography (HPLC)/Liquid Chromatography (LC)Resolve DOI
CamphorLeavesEssential oil19.9 PercentGC-MSResolve DOI
CoumarinsFruit peelSolvent extractionNuclear Magnetic Resonance (NMR)Resolve DOI
CoumarinsUnspecifiedEssential oilHPLC-DADResolve DOI
FuranocoumarinsFruit peelSolvent extractionNuclear Magnetic Resonance (NMR)Resolve DOI
FuranocoumarinsUnspecifiedEssential oilHPLC-DADResolve DOI
IsopimpinellinFruit peelSolvent extraction6862 Microgram/100 millilitreHigh Performance Liquid Chromatography (HPLC)/Liquid Chromatography (LC)Resolve DOI
IsopimpinellinFruit peelSolvent extractionHigh Performance Liquid Chromatography (HPLC)/Liquid Chromatography (LC)Resolve DOI
LimettinFruit peelSolvent extraction52.6 Microgram/100 millilitreHigh Performance Liquid Chromatography (HPLC)/Liquid Chromatography (LC)Resolve DOI
LimettinFruit peelSolvent extractionHigh Performance Liquid Chromatography (HPLC)/Liquid Chromatography (LC)Resolve DOI
MyrceneUnspecifiedEssential oil≥ 1.2 PercentGC-MSResolve DOI
MyrceneUnspecifiedEssential oil≤ 1.3 PercentGC-MSResolve DOI

Cited sources

The literature the compendium cites for this species. Metatron Health has no relationship with these authors or journals and earns nothing from citing them.

  1. Belewu, M.A., Olatunde, O.A., Giwa, T.A. Underutilized medicinal plants and spices: Chemical composition and phytochemical properties. Journal of Medicinal Plants Research, 2009, vol. 3, no. 12, p. 1099-1103.
  2. Dugo, P., Mondello, L., Lamonica, G., Dugo, G. Characterization of cold-pressed Key and Persian lime oils by gas chromatography, gas chromatography mass spectroscopy, high-performance liquid chromatography, and physicochemical indices. JOURNAL OF AGRICULTURAL AND FOOD CHEMISTRY, 1997, vol. 45, no. 9, p. 3608-3616. DOI
  3. Gorgus, E., Lohr, C., Raquet, N., Guth, S., Schrenk, D. Limettin and furocoumarins in beverages containing citrus juices or extracts. FOOD AND CHEMICAL TOXICOLOGY, 2010, vol. 48, no. 1, p. 93-98. DOI
  4. Shalaby, N.M.M., Abd-Alla, H.I., Ahmed, H.H., Basoudan, N. Protective effect of Citrus sinensis and Citrus aurantifolia against osteoporosis and their phytochemical constituents. Journal of Medicinal Plants Research, 2011, vol. 5, no. 4, p. 579-588.
  5. Nigg, H.N., Nordby, H.E., Beier, R.C., Dillman, A., Macias, C., Hansen, R.C. Phototoxic coumarins in limes. Food and Chemical Toxicology, 1993, vol. 31, no. 5, p. 331-335. DOI
  6. Sandoval-Montemayor, Nallely E., Garcia, Abraham., Elizondo-Trevino, Elizabeth., Garza-Gonzalez, Elvira., Alvarez, Laura., del Rayo Camacho-Corona, Maria. Chemical Composition of Hexane Extract of Citrus aurantifolia and Anti-Mycobacterium tuberculosis Activity of Some of Its Constituents. MOLECULES, 2012, vol. 17, no. 9, p. 11173-11184. DOI
  7. Ebana, R.U.B., Madunagu, B.E., Ekpe, E.D., Otung, I.N. Microbiological exploitation of cardiac glycosides and alkaloids from Garcinia kola, Borreria ocymoides, Kola nitida and Citrus aurantifolia. Journal of Applied Bacteriology, 1991, vol. 71, no. 5, p. 398-401.
  8. Chaiyana, Wantida., Okonogi, Siriporn. Inhibition of cholinesterase by essential oil from food plant. PHYTOMEDICINE, 2012, vol. 19, no. 8-9, p. 836-839. DOI
